Minister of Environment Yasmine Fouad on Tuesday met with ambassadors of the European Union and President of European Investment Bank to discuss strengthening joint cooperation and supporting Egypt’s hosting of the COP27 climate conference. Fouad stressed the strength of joint cooperation between Egypt and the European Union over the past years in environmental issues, and the investment of this cooperation in supporting the fight against climate change. During the meeting, Fouad reviewed Egypt’s efforts regarding its tackling of climate change. It has worked with development partners to attract climate finance in many areas, including confronting energy shortages by implementing energy projects. Fouad stressed that Egypt took the decision to host the COP27 climate conference in 2022 to complete what will result from the COP 26 climate conference, and invest in its partnership with the United Kingdom within the coalition to confront and adapt to the effects of climate change.
